OptiPlex 3040 SFF

Will the GTX 750 low profile fit in the 3040 SFF? And it's gonna work? I have a Intel Core i5-6500 3.60GHz,

    For the fitments, single slot, low profile graphics cards will fit.  If your variant of GTX 750 is double slot card, it will not.

    For power requirement, a 250w power supply is suggested.  Although OP did not disclosed the PSU info, the OptiPlex 3040 SFF has 180w power supply.  It should be taken into concern and considering for upgrade.

    even though the card has a single slot bracket, it may have a heatsink > 1 slot width thick, such as 1.5 slot width.  the 3000 series SFF does not support card with thick heatsink due to psu only 1 slot width from PCIex16 slot.  if you move the psu outside case then it would be possible.
